#include <bits/stdc++.h>

#define pb push_back

using namespace std;

typedef long long ll;
typedef vector<ll> vll;


bool solve(vll &v, ll len)
{
    if (v.size() < len) return false;

    vll cost(v.size()+1, 0);

    ll currentCost = 0;
    for (int i = 0; i < v.size(); ++i) {
        currentCost += cost[i];
        if (v[i] + currentCost > 0) {
            if (i + len > v.size()) return false;
            else {
                cost[i] -= (v[i] + currentCost);
                cost[i+len] += (v[i] + currentCost);
                currentCost -= (v[i] + currentCost);
            }
        }
        if (v[i] + currentCost < 0) return false;
    }

    return true;
}

int main()
{
    ios_base::sync_with_stdio(0);

    ll n;
    cin >> n;

    vll v(n);
    ll sum = 0;

    for (int i = 0; i < n; ++i) {
        cin >> v[i];
        sum += v[i];
    }

    ll result = 1;
    for (int i = 1; i*i <= sum && i <= n; ++i) {
        if (sum % i == 0) {
            if (solve(v, i)) {
                if (i > result) result = i;
            }
             if (solve(v, sum/i)) {
                if (sum/i > result) result = sum/i;
            }
        }
    }

    cout << result << endl;
}
